Khuan Khong Bon
Khuan Khong Bon is a hill in Khlong Sai, Na Thawi, Songkhla Province and has an elevation of 145 metres. Khuan Khong Bon is situated nearby to the village Ban Lam Ching, as well as near the locality Ban Muang No Kaeo.| Tap on a place to explore it |
